sqlserver从入门到精通
时间: 2024-12-18 07:12:37 浏览: 8
SQL_Server从入门到精通
4星 · 用户满意度95%
SQL Server是从入门到精通的一个过程,主要包括以下几个阶段:
1. **基础学习**:首先,你需要了解SQL语言的基本语法,如查询(SELECT)、数据插入(INSERT)、更新(UPDATE)、删除(DELETE)等基本操作。同时,熟悉数据库的概念,如表、视图、索引和事务。
2. **数据库管理**:掌握如何创建、修改和管理数据库结构,包括创建数据库、表格、添加列以及设置约束。理解数据类型、存储过程和触发器的作用。
3. **查询优化**:学习如何编写高效的SQL查询,包括连接(JOIN)、分组(GROUP BY)、排序(ORDER BY)以及性能分析工具(如EXPLAIN)的使用。
4. **T-SQL高级特性**:深入学习存储过程、函数、临时表、变量,以及如何利用窗口函数和CTE(Common Table Expression)进行复杂的数据处理。
5. **安全性**:学会如何配置用户权限、角色和数据库的安全策略,保护敏感信息。
6. **备份恢复和维护**:理解定期备份的重要性,并能执行备份和恢复操作。还要掌握性能监控和故障排查技巧。
7. **SQL Server Management Studio (SSMS)**:熟练使用SSMS进行日常管理和调试工作。
8. **分布式系统**:对SQL Server Cluster、Replication和Azure SQL的相关知识有一定了解,如果涉及云计算环境,这部分尤为重要。
9. **实践经验**:通过实际项目操作,不断积累经验,提升解决问题的能力。
阅读全文